Droso Lab, Ffnu
Droso Lab is branch of the Functional Foods and Nutraceutical Unit (FFNU) of Federal University of Technology, Akure where Drosophila melanogaster is being used as model for degenerative diseases and molecular researches. The head of the lab is Prof. Ganiyu Oboh who is also the director of Centre for Research and Development, FUTA

The Passion For Research Hub
With about 17.51% of the World’s 7.83 Billion Population (Szmigier, 2021), Africa generates less than 1% of the world’s research output (Duermeijer et al, 2018), This is most likely due to her spending on research, not more than 1% it’s entire GDP (Kigotho, 2021), signifying below the capacity performance of its populations, validating the anecdotal common saying, the best way to hide something from a black-Man is to put in a book. It’s a fact, many Nigerian tertiary institutions don’t have an archiving platform for their undergraduate’s research works, reflecting a lack of value for students' intellectual property. Africa has poor research culture, and this is because of her poor emphasis on research and which has continued to further her backwardness in societal evolutionary trajectory. It’s in this great burden of heart, that we present to you 'The Passion For Research Hub’, the first of her kind Non-Governmental organisation in Africa, to champion the instilling of research consciousness, in the minds of the Sons and Daughters of Africa.

Open Science Community Nigeria
A scientist-driven nonprofit organisation working to embed open science principles and practices, promote openness, transparency and reproducibility in science. Open Science Community Nigeria (OSCN) is also part of the International Network of Open Science Communities & Scholarship (INOSC).
